Yin Yoga

Slow, steady, long held poses to create ease in the body.

 

Yin ~ that which is hidden, still, stable, calm.

 

On a physical level we target the body’s yin tissues to increase our range of motion, our mobility…. to juice our joints. The practice involves less muscular engagement than our yang form of exercise, providing a wonderful balance.

When we practice yin yoga we hold poses for some time, as it generally takes the connective tissue time to relax - the longer the hold, the more benefit is derived. There is no rush. Our breath then becomes our focus, our barometer, allowing us to tune into our body. Awareness of our body grows, the mobility of our joints increases and we begin to move with grace and fluidity. Stillness in the body while we practice helps us to calm the breath.

Energetically yin yoga increases our vitality and creates balance within our body’s systems, by stimulating the flow of chi (prana) throughout the body’s meridians (channels) and their related organs. When we have an imbalance or blockage of chi within the body this can lead to illness. Our practice has the power to heal and balance the body by pushing, pulling and pressurizing these tissues.

Our practice gives us time to feel emotions that otherwise may go unnoticed in our busy day-to-day lives. We observe what arises, pleasant and unpleasant emotions and sensations, then without judgement, we let them go. This highlights that everything in life is in flux, changing and impermanent.

With yin we are awakening our contemplative nature, becoming more aware and attentive to what is stirring within us. We are enlivening our mind and gaining clarity of thought. The result of our practice is increased compassion for ourselves and others, we realize true happiness is within and we can express our wisdom.
